When Trust is Broken: What Qualifies as Medical Malpractice?


Clinical negligence takes place when a healthcare provider deviates from the accepted requirement of treatment, which inconsistency leads to injury to a person. It's not enough that a poor outcome occurred; the focus hinges on whether the healthcare expert acted negligently or incompetently.


Some common situations consist of:



  • A delayed diagnosis that aggravates a person's condition

  • Surgery executed on the incorrect website

  • Wrong medicine dosage or prescription

  • Birth injuries arising from improper prenatal care


In these instances, proving malpractice involves showing that a medical standard was breached, and that violation triggered direct injury. This isn't constantly easy-- and that's where a proficient supporter can be found in.

Individual Rights: More Than Just a Legal Concept


As a person, you have civil liberties-- and those rights are not optional. They're the structure of safe and moral medical therapy. One of one of the most essential legal rights is the right to educated permission. This means you should be totally educated concerning the possible threats and advantages of any type of therapy or treatment before it occurs.


You also deserve to prompt and proficient treatment, the right to ask inquiries, and the right to obtain sincere answers. When any of these legal rights are jeopardized, and damage outcomes, it becomes an issue worth examining.

From Doubt to Action: What to Do If You Suspect Malpractice


If you think that you or a loved one has been a target of clinical malpractice, it can be challenging to recognize where to start. The most essential action is to trust your impulses. If something feels off, you have every right to ask questions and seek a second opinion.


Begin by gathering all your medical records and recording your experience. Make a note of days, names of clinical service providers, and the details of conversations and treatments. This details can end up being important in constructing a case.
